Ogun release N1.5bn for pensioners, ex-political office holders

businessday-icon

The Ogun State Government has released the sum of N1.5 billion for the payment of gratuities to pensioners and severance package of former political office holders.

According to the official information obtained by BusinessDay, the money will be paid to 561 ex-civil servants and some former political office holders who had earlier served the State in different capacities.

In a statement signed by Yusuph Olaniyonu, Commissioner for Information and Strategy, the gratuities will cover the civil servants who retired between May 2011 and November 2012 who have filed their papers with the State Bureau of Pensions while ex- political office holders who served between 2007 and 2011 but were not paid their severance package by the last administration will benefit from the fund.

The fresh release of N1.5 billion will further clear the arrears of pensions which dated back to 2008 inherited by the Governor Amosun Administration. With the release of fund, the arrears are due to be cleared up to November 2012.

The payment of gratuity and severance package is a further fulfilment of the promise by Governor Ibikunle Amosun to ensure that everybody who served the state in various capacities and contributed to its development will be paid their dues since the current office holders will one day leave office to become ex- office holders.
